Description

A creamy and flavorful Cajun Potato Soup that combines hearty potatoes with a blend of spices for a delicious meal.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 bell pepper, diced (any color)
  • 2 medium carrots, diced
  • 2 celery stalks, diced
  • 4 medium potatoes, peeled and cubed
  • 4 cups chicken bro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 tablespoon Cajun seasoning
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ional, for extra heat)
  • 1 cup cooked and crumbled bacon (optional)
  • 2 green onions, sliced (for garnish)
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Instructions

  1. In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the diced onion, garlic, bell pepper, carrots, and celery. Sauté for about 5-7 minutes until the vegetables are softened.
  2. Stir in the cubed potatoes, chicken broth, Cajun seasoning, salt, black pepper, and cayenne pepper (if using).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low and let simmer for 20-25 minutes, or until the potatoes are tender.
  3. Once the potatoes are cooked, use a potato masher or immersion blender to mash some of the potatoes for a creamier texture, leaving some chunks for heartiness.
  4. Stir in the heavy cream and let the soup heat through for an additional 5 minutes.
  5. If using, stir in the crumbled bacon just before serving.
  6. Serve hot, garnished with sliced green onions and chopped parsley.

Notes

  • For a vegetarian version, substitute the chicken broth with vegetable broth and omit the bacon.
  • Add 1 cup of corn or diced tomatoes for extra flavor and texture.
